Details
Controls: 3-position polar pattern switch (omni/cardioid/figure-8), bass-cut switch (6 dB/octave below 100 Hz)
I/O: Multi-pin cable from mic to dedicated tube power supply with internal switchable AC voltage; PSU provides balanced XLR-3M line output
Notable use: Compared favorably to a Neumann U67 by engineer Steve Genewick (Capitol Studios)
